Sainx Franchise

1. Brand & Franchise Snapshot

Brand Name Sainx
Industry Logistics & Courier Services
Business Category Freight Forwarding & Express Courier
Founded Year 2021
Franchise Started Year 2021
Total Franchise Outlets 1–10
Estimated Investment INR 2 Lakh – 5 Lakh
Franchise/Brand Fee INR 2,00,000
Royalty Fee 10% of business generated
Space Requirement 250–500 sq.ft.
Staff Requirement Small team to handle operations, customer service, and logistics coordination
Expected Payback Period Less than 3 months

2. Understanding the Brand

Sainx operates in the logistics and express courier sector, providing freight forwarding, shipment handling, and end-to-end delivery solutions for businesses and individuals. The brand caters to customers seeking timely, reliable, and professional logistics services. This franchise opportunity falls within the broader courier and logistics franchise category.

3. Operating Concept

Franchise outlets function as local service centers for Sainx, handling incoming and outgoing shipments, coordinating deliveries, and supporting clients in booking and tracking consignments. Customers interact through walk-ins, online portals, or corporate accounts. Revenue is generated primarily through shipment fees, courier charges, and value-added logistics services. Daily operations involve documentation, cargo management, and customer support.

6. Investment and Startup Requirements

Initial investment covers:

Franchise Fee INR 2,00,000
Setup Costs Outlet rent, furniture, computers, and logistics tools
Working Capital Inventory and operational expenses
Royalty 10% on total business generated

The investment is structured to allow quick operational readiness and rapid ROI.

7. Outlet Setup and Infrastructure

Franchise setup requires:

Space 250–500 sq.ft., suitable for office operations and package handling
Location Accessible commercial areas with high client footfall
Equipment Computers, printers, shipment management software, storage for packages
Staffing Small team to handle operations, customer service, and coordination with Sainx network

10. Brand Background and Growth

Founded in 2021 by Prashant Bhagat, Sainx has rapidly developed into a logistics provider with a global presence in 50 strategic locations. The franchise model allows local entrepreneurs to leverage Sainx’s operational expertise, technology, and international network to enter the courier and freight forwarding market efficiently.
